Hi I’m Josie Haskins. During lockdown 2020, I decided to set up a little jewellery business selling handmade jewellery, and little gifts. I decided I wanted to make a Chloe jewellery collection, in honour and in memory of my sister Chloe Haskins, who suddenly passed away from meningitis B in Feb 2018, at just 18 years old.
The Chloe collection I have created is mainly to reflect the colour of the meningitis research foundation which is purple. I am also making other jewellery in the styles of what I think Chloe would have liked too.
When you buy a Chloe collection piece of jewellery a % of the proceeds is donated to The Meningitis Research Foundation, the amounts are stated on each piece.
Chloe was such a beautiful girl: bright, bubbly and friendly. She was so kind and wise - the best sister I could have ever asked for. She wasn’t just my sister, she was my best friend, too. She always looked out for me and cared for me so much. Even though I only got to spend 15 years of my life with her, Chloe will always live on in my heart.
